Explore Burgos on a short self-guided walk through medieval streets, grand plazas, and a city crowned by its magnificent Gothic cathedral and Castilian heritage.

Highlights


  • Stand before a life-sized Christ figure crafted from buffalo leather with real hair and jointed limbs — pulled from the sea during a storm

  • Trace the Camino de Santiago through streets that once held thirty-four taverns serving a quarter-million pilgrims a year

  • Visit the palace where Columbus reported back from the Americas and one of the earliest human rights treaties was signed

  • Learn why Burgos's most brilliant architect was rejected by his own city — and went on to design one of Spain's greatest cathedrals

  • Taste your way through morcilla, wood-fired suckling lamb, and tapas with names too colourful to translate politely
